Mush With Cream Syrup Recipe


Mush With Cream Syrup Recipe
Eaten alot in the depression when there was not much to eat back then.Don't know how my grandparents did it.

Ingredients
  • Fried Corn-Meal Mush:
  • Bring to boil 2-3/4 Cups water,combine 1 Cup Corn Meal,1 Cup Cold Water,1 teaspoon Salt,and 1 teaspoon Sugar.Gradually add to boiling water,stirring constantly.
  • Cook till thick,stirring often.Cover,cook over low heat 10 to 15 minutes.
  • Pour into a 8x3x2" Loaf pan.Cool,Chill overnight.
  • Turn out,cut into 1/2" slices.Fry slowly in bacon grease or hot oil,turning once.When browned serve buttered and with cream syrup.
  • Cream Syrup:
  • 1 to 1-1/2 Cups Sugar
  • Cream or canned milk,just enough liquid to make a thick syrup.
  • Place on burner and bring to a boil,may boil over,so watch.
  • Allow to boil for a few seconds then remove from burner.
  • Add 1-1/2 teaspoons Vanilla
  • Grandparents used sorghum for the cream syrup,I prefer the cream syrup myself.
